    Get rid of the red google ads. Use the blue color instead. Don't make them stand out so much like they're ads.

    Get rid of the google 300x250 or similar - whatever that section is - way too obvious as ads and totally distracting from your content. You don't need these! Keep the 120x600 google ads on the right. These are large and powerful enough.

    If you must, keep the 468x60 google ads in between your posts. Google will only show a maximum of 3 per page anyways, so you're safe in including these after each post and/or whatever you're doing.
